Why Buy Local? The Benefits of Visiting a Power Tools Shop Near Me
In an era controlled by e-commerce giants, going to a physical storefront might appear old-fashioned. However, when it pertains to durable equipment, heading to a regional retailer provides value that websites just can not duplicate.
- Immediate Availability: Projects typically work on tight schedules. Waiting days for a delivery to get here can stall progress. Purchasing locally implies picking up the devices and getting straight to work.
- The "Feel" Test: Ergonomics matter. A drill or saw might look fantastic online, however holding it in-hand exposes its real weight, balance, and grip comfort.
- Expert Guidance: Local hardware and tool professionals typically have years of experience. They can recommend on the very best torque, battery platform, or safety devices for a particular application.
- Easier Returns and Repairs: If a tool is defective or requires warranty service, dealing with a local storefront is normally much faster and less discouraging than delivering a heavy item back through the mail.
What to Look for in a Quality Power Tools Shop
Not all tool stores are created equivalent. When assessing options in the area, consumers should search for particular traits that different average hardware shops from leading tool locations.
1. Brand Variety and Ecosystems
A great power tools shop will carry several industry-leading brand names, permitting buyers to compare options side-by-side. Additionally, they must equip whole battery ecosystems (such as 18V, 20V Max, or 40V platforms), making it easy to cross-compatible batteries across drills, saws, and sanders.
2. Dedicated Service and Repair Departments
Top-tier shops do not just offer tools; they keep them running. Search for locations that provide in-house repair work services, replacement parts, and accessory honing.
3. Demonstrations and Hands-On Displays
The best retailers include interactive screen locations where consumers can test-drive tools, feel the power of brushless motors, and assess dust-collection systems before making a purchase investment.

Walking into a tool store without a plan can lead to decision fatigue. Consumers can simplify their journey by preparing the following details in advance:
- Define the Scope of Work: Is this for light home maintenance, heavy woodworking, or durable building?
- Pick Corded vs. Cordless: Consider whether job-site movement is more vital than constant, continuous power.
- Set a Realistic Budget: Factor in not simply the bare tool, however needed devices like batteries, battery chargers, drill bit sets, saw blades, and safety gear.

2. Can I lease power tools instead of buying them?
Lots of local hardware shops and specialized tool stores use equipment rental services. This is ideal for pricey, specialized tools-- like concrete saws, sturdy demolition hammers, or flooring sanders-- that are just required for a single task.
3. How do I know which battery platform to select?
Adhering to a single brand's battery environment is usually best. If a buyer already owns several tools from a specific brand name (e.g., DeWalt, Milwaukee, or Makita), purchasing bare tools from that exact same brand name enables them to reuse existing batteries and chargers, conserving considerable cash.
4. Do regional power tool stores use warranties?
Yes. Authorized dealerships honor complete producer warranties. Additionally, lots of independent stores function as service centers to assist process repair work quickly if something goes incorrect.
